What is a LLC?
A LLC, often referred to as an Limited Liability Company, represents one widely-used form of business organization in the U.S. that merges the legal shield of a corporate entity corporation the fiscal benefits and operational flexibility of a collaborative business model. Such entities are created to provide protection against personal liability to their stakeholders, known as members, meaning that members typically are not personally responsible for the financial obligations and liabilities of the business. This shield can help protect individual holdings, making these entities an attractive option for many entrepreneurs.
In addition to liability protection, LLCs provide significant tax advantages. By standard, LLCs are pass-through entities for tax purposes, meaning that the business's financial gains and deficits can be declared on the owners' personal tax returns, avoiding the dual taxation that can affect corporate entities. Members can also choose how they want the company to be treated for tax purposes, whether as an individual business owner, collaborative entity, or corporate entity, providing the ability to adjust to their financial situations.
Creating an Limited Liability Company requires registering with the appropriate state authority in which the company will conduct business, which can typically be done through an LLC company search on the local business registration site. This procedure consists of filing articles of organization and covering a registration fee. Additionally, these companies may need to adhere to certain operational requirements based on local laws, which can vary significantly across the United States. Understanding these factors is crucial for anyone considering an LLC as their preferred business structure.

How to Conduct an Limited Liability Company Search
Conducting an LLC search is an important step for anyone looking to confirm the status of a company or obtain necessary information about its organization. The first step is to visit the online database of your state's State Secretary, where you can typically find a dedicated section for entity lookups. Most states provide user-friendly interfaces that allow you to type the company's name or the Limited Liability Company registration number. This search will provide you with information such as the company's formation date, status, and registered agent details.
Once you have found the basic information about the LLC, you may want to dig deeper. Some states provide additional data that includes the names of the owners or administrators, the business address, and sometimes even yearly filing filings. If the information is not fully available on the internet, you may need to reach out to the state's department directly or go in person to obtain the required papers. Being persistent can be beneficial, as every bit of data helps in understanding the company more thoroughly.
If you are performing a company lookup across various states or searching for nationwide information, you can utilize specialized online services that aggregate information from various state registries. These tools usually charge a cost but can spare you hours and offer detailed reports covering several aspects of an LLC. Whether you are evaluating a business partnership, investment, or legal issues, having accurate information is key to making wise choices.
